[15F-T13-02] Feasibility Study on the Application of Ti-Zr Alloys for Fabrication of Porous Ti-Based Biometals via Powder Metallurgy

*S.-J. Seo1, T. Fujii1, Y. Shimamura1 (1.Shizuoka University, Japan)

キーワード:Biometal, Spark plasma sintering, Mechanical property

Biometals for medical implants are required to have both low stiffness and high strength. Although porous Ti with low stiffness has been proposed, its application to load-bearing biometals is difficult because of low strength. In this study, the feasibility of using Ti-Zr alloys as a scaffold material for porous biometals is investigated. Ti and Zr powders mixed in various volume fractions are simultaneously sintered by spark plasma sintering to fabricate dense compacts. As a result, the Ti-25Zr alloy exhibits the highest bending strength of 1510 MPa in the Ti-Zr alloys, while the bending strength of monolithic Ti is 918 MPa, indicating that the Ti-25Zr alloy is suitable as a scaffold of porous biometal.
